首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用jquery在单击时中断ajax生成的表

使用jQuery在单击时中断ajax生成的表

答:在使用jQuery进行ajax请求生成表格时,如果需要在单击事件发生时中断ajax请求生成的表格,可以使用abort()方法来取消当前的ajax请求。

具体步骤如下:

  1. 首先,创建一个ajax请求对象,使用$.ajax()方法来发送ajax请求。例如:
代码语言:javascript
复制
var xhr = $.ajax({
  url: "your_url",
  type: "GET",
  dataType: "json",
  success: function(data) {
    // 在请求成功时生成表格
    generateTable(data);
  }
});
  1. 接下来,在单击事件发生时,调用abort()方法来中断ajax请求。例如:
代码语言:javascript
复制
$("#your_button").click(function() {
  xhr.abort(); // 中断ajax请求
});

这样,在单击按钮时,ajax请求将会被中断,不再继续发送请求,并且不会生成表格。

关于中断ajax请求的更多信息,可以参考jQuery官方文档中的相关章节:jQuery.ajax()

推荐的腾讯云相关产品:腾讯云对象存储(COS)

腾讯云对象存储(COS)是一种安全、高可靠、低成本的云端存储服务,适用于存储和处理任意类型的文件,包括文档、图片、音视频等。它提供了简单易用的API接口,方便开发者进行文件的上传、下载、管理等操作。

优势:

  • 高可靠性:腾讯云COS采用分布式存储架构,数据可靠性高达99.999999999%。
  • 高性能:支持高并发读写,可满足大规模文件存储和访问需求。
  • 低成本:按实际使用量计费,无需预付费,成本低廉。
  • 安全可靠:提供多种安全机制,如身份验证、权限管理等,保障数据安全。

应用场景:

  • 网站图片、视频等静态资源的存储和分发。
  • 大规模文件的备份和存档。
  • 云端应用的文件上传和下载。

产品介绍链接地址:腾讯云对象存储(COS)

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

AjaxjQuery异步加载数据

由于用 jQuery 实现 ajax 比较简单,因此接下来代码引用jQuery库实现Ajax,另外使用Django作为框架。 其中jQuery可以手动下载放到本地文件夹中,也可以引用下面的语句。...动态更新页面的情况下,用户无法回到前一个页面状态,这是因为浏览器仅能记下历史记录中静态页面。...一个被完整读入页面与一个已经被动态修改过页面之间可能差别非常微妙;用户通常都希望单击后退按钮,就能够取消他们前一次操作,但是Ajax应用程序中,却无法这样做。...不过开发者已想出了种种办法来解决这个问题,HTML5之前方法大多是在用户单击后退按钮访问历史记录,通过创建或使用一个隐藏IFRAME来重现页面上变更。...(例如,当用户Google Maps中单击后退,它在一个隐藏IFRAME中进行搜索,然后将搜索结果反映到Ajax元素上,以便将应用程序状态恢复到当时状态)。

10.9K20

Jquery 使用技巧总结

二、使用方法 需要使用JQuery页面中引入JQueryjs文件即可。...》和《使用 jQuery 简化 Ajax 开发》 (说明:以上文档都放在了【附件】中) 四、语法总结和注意事项 1、关于页面元素引用 通过jquery$()引用元素包括通过id、class、...2、jQuery对象与dom对象转换 只有jquery对象才能使用jquery定义方法。注意dom对象和jquery对象是有区别的,调用方法要注意操作是dom对象还是jquery对象。...Jquery已经为我们提供了各种事件处理方法,我们无需html元素上直接写事件,而可以直接为通过jquery获取对象添加事件。...把一个数组中项目(处理转换后)保存到到另一个新数组中,并返回生成新数组。

2.8K20

使用jQuery UIdraggable和droppable完成拖拽功能--介绍

说明:拖动父节点到右侧,它包含叶子节点都需要拖到右边 3.树形类默认可以折叠,单击展开,再单击就折叠。...项目中主要使用jQuery UI里面的draggable和droppable,因为很多老浏览器都不值html5drag api。...我自己也没有去查看zTree源代码,所以也不知道zTree底层拖拽实现是否也是使用jQuery UIdraggable和droppable方法。...同时因为zTree考虑到具体业务需求,对大数据处理可以使用ajax方法,而我自己实现,因为后台返回数据是json格式,而且数据量不是非常大,所以没有考虑着一块。...当然下次打开系统,必须通过反方法把右边数据生成如图结果。

2.2K50

Web API--入门--(一)ASP.NET Web API 2(C#)入门

ASP.NET Web API是.NET Framework之上构建Web API框架。本教程中,您将使用ASP.NET Web API创建返回产品列表Web API。...使用Javascript和jQuery调用Web API 本节中,我们将添加一个使用AJAX调用Web APIHTML页面。我们将使用jQuery来进行AJAX调用,并且还可以使用结果更新页面。...在这个例子中,我使用了Microsoft Ajax CDN。您还可以从http://jquery.com/下载它,ASP.NET“Web API”项目模板也包括jQuery。...jQuery getJSON函数发送一个AJAX请求。对于响应包含JSON对象数组。该done函数指定在请求成功时调用回调。回调中,我们使用产品信息更新DOM。...如果您输入ID无效,则服务器返回HTTP错误: ? 使用F12查看HTTP请求和响应 当您使用HTTP服务,查看HTTP请求和请求消息非常有用。

4.2K10

JavaEE中为删除数据操作与退出操作添加确认提示框

使我们单击,即可触发del()函数,并传入要删除用户id 2、通过Ajax,向servlet发送要删除用户id并接收执行删除操作后servlet通过直接响应发送值( resp.getWriter...以用户退出为例 1、添加id属性 2、通过jquery添加相应函数 以删除指定empId员工为例 一、js方式 1、jsp界面中,找到删除按钮所在地方,为其添加超链接javascript:delEmp...注意: 如果需要传入int类型,则在使用el表达式调用时,外部可以不加单引号。 而如果传入string类型,则需要在其外部加单引号。...二、Ajax方式 1、定位到删除操作,通过javaScript:void(0)阻断a标签href属性。使我们单击,即可触发del()函数,并传入要删除用户id ?...2、通过jquery添加相应函数 ?

1.9K40

富Web应用架构与转化方法:Web应用系列第二篇

本课程中,我们将使用RichFaces组件。 丰富应用程序标志之一是缺少页面重新加载和减少页面导航。例如,您在表单上输入数据,然后单击“提交”按钮。没有明显等待响应。...这是因为是使用Ajax技术将数据传输到服务器并在后台接收响应。 鉴于Ajax和丰富UI组件组合,我们看到单个工作单元一个页面上完成。...快速入门演示了使用jQuery注册新成员显示消息。 如何在页面上放置一个组件,例如列出当前库存表格,并在库存发生变化时自动更新,即使库存交易不是来自你? 使用RichFaces推送。...Javascript回调函数ondataavailable执行包含jQuery逻辑代码。 push标签内,我们有一个标签。...此标记声明每当调用dataavailable回调,都会呈现包含成员列表数据可折叠面板。 四、客户端验证 我们可以使用RichFaces使用Ajax支持字段验证。

3.5K20

ajax使用案例

这样的话就是每次点击1处某条数据内容,2处对应这条数据id2处内容在后端查询出来并在下面这个ul中显示。...显示是根据2处数据条数用ajax等语言创建li标签并变量代替生成相同格式标签。)。点1处每条数据,2处都是不停切换,这就是之间关联。后台需要做很多操作。...所以插入li标签比如开发者工具,要将这个api返回数据中id数作为开发者工具这个li一个属性记录下来。点击事件反生就根据获取到id属性值,来显示另一个中相同这个外键id数据内容。...这个又关联了一张 2能看出来 下面红框就是又关联另一张: 关联另一张也面这里进行展示: 注意res返回数据中有data属性和data方法,我们使用数据用是data属性,直接...这里res.data是个数组,循环数组元素要res.data.forEach(function(item,index){}) 然后要做生成子追加到父;子是生成子标签,子标签要用到反引号,子中要用到变量使用

11.6K20

jQuery (二)

使用jQuery处理事件 事件处理 一个栗子,单击p背景变成灰色 由于es6箭头函数不支持this绑定,所以无法使用箭头函数,只能使用匿名函数 html <!...'gray'); }); 效果 [20180821_175532.gif] 或者使用第二个参数,添加相关属性,完成事件相关触发 // 单击任意p,使其背景变成灰色 $('', { src...https://api.jquery.com/category/events/event-object/ 自定义事件 一个栗子,实现发布订阅模型,先全体元素广播一个事件,单击一个按钮时候 $('#...中默认队列名为fx,这是没有指定队列名默认使用队列。...dataFileter 过滤或者预处理服务器返回数据 ajax事件 ajax还会在请求时候,触发相应事件 这个用于在请求某些图片时候,图片仍旧继续下载时候,使用相应时间,提示出图片正在加载中

9.3K30

全网最新、最全jQuery核心知识,你真的不想点开看看嘛?

为什么使用 jQuery 它能够兼容市面上主流浏览器, IE 和 FireFox,Google 浏览器 处理 AJAX,创建异步对象是不同,而 jQuery 能够使用一种方式不同浏览器创建 AJAX...一般情况下,命名jQuery对象,为了与DOM对象进行区分,习惯性以 开头,这不是必须。...使用jQuery函数,实现Ajax请求。 15.1 关于jQuery函数使用Ajax请求介绍。 jQuery 提供多个与 AJAX 有关方法。...dataType:表示期望从服务端返回数据格式。当我们使用 $.ajax() 发送请求,会把 ​ dataType值发送给服务端。...使用jQuery以及Ajax实现省市级联查询 使用地方:比如填写淘宝收货地址时候,省份来点击河北省,下一个市区栏会自动变为河北省以下市区名,选择好市区名下一栏会出现该市区内街道等信息 我们这里使用一下

5.8K10

ASP.NET Ajax

Microsoft AJAX 客户端库已重构,可以和jQuery协同工作,拆分为单独文件如下图所示: ? 整个库中单个脚本文件之间依赖关系如下: ?...使用 ASP.NET Ajax母版-详细信息视图 随便介绍一个JavaScript 代码质量工具JSLint,可对 JavaScript 代码块运行多种静态分析检查。...默认情况下,JSLint 遇到以下内容将显示警告:全局变量;没有使用分号结束语句;后面没有语句块 if、while、do 和 for 语句;无法访问代码及其他情况。...若要使用 JSLint,请访问 JSLint.com,将您 JavaScript 代码粘贴到文本框,选择对应选项并单击“JSLint”按钮。然后,JSLint 将分析您代码并显示错误列表。...由 JSLint 识别的错误显示“任务列表”窗口中。您甚至可以将 JSLint.VS 配置为每次生成该项目在所选文件或文件夹上运行。

1.6K50

Asp.Net MVC +EntityFramework主从新增编辑操作实现(删除操作怎么实现?)

我在网上搜索了很久都没有发现很完整实例或非常好解决方案,所以我很想和大家讨论一下又什么更好解决方案。 一旦有更好方式我会把它集成到模板中实现自动生成。所以很希望得到大家帮助。...功能: 查询页面上可以单击新增和编辑进行对数据维护 页面的结构是上部是维护表头,下部Table是现实子表数据,对子表数据维护使用bootstrap popup modal方式操作。...doing its thing return false; }) OrderController 添加一个新增体和修改Action用于生产对应Partial View 我在这里也试过OrderController...中不添加对子表操作Action,完全使用JS完成对行操作,但在对编辑现有体数据出现了问题。...,而不删添加一个删除标志,这同样也会带来很多操作,如Table laod数据还要把带删除标志行筛选掉,又要添加好多代码 不知道你们是否有很好解决方案

1.8K80

AJAX常见面试问题

使用JSONP形式调用函数,例如myurl?callback=?,JQuery将自动替换后一个“?”为正确函数名,以执行回调函数。 text:返回纯文本字符串。...一个被完整读入页面与一个已经被动态修改过页面之间差别非常微妙;用户通常会希望单击后退按钮能够取消他们前一次操作,但是Ajax应用程序中,这将无法实现。...答案是肯定,用过Gmail知道,Gmail下面采用Ajax技术解决了这个问题,Gmail下面是可以后退,但是,它也并不能改变Ajax机制,它只是采用一个比较笨但是有效办法,即用户单击后退按钮访问历史记录...(例如,当用户Google Maps中单击后退,它在一个隐藏IFRAME中进行搜索,然后将搜索结果反映到Ajax元素上,以便将应用程序状态恢复到当时状态。)...同源策略规定在访问如果域名,协议,端口与发起请求地方不一致,就属于跨域请求, 这种时候,需要使用一些跨域请求技术, 一: 利用JQuery方法,使用JSONP模式访问,dataType:‘jsonp

1.8K20

ztree实现编辑和删除功能

前面写了一篇ztree实现根节点单击事件,显示节点信息https://www.jianshu.com/p/1e0ca6d8afad,其中删除和编辑功能是自定义实现,现在直接使用文档里面的功能。...实现效果如下图示: ? 1:首先要引入相关文件,注意一定要引入这个jquery.ztree.exedit-3.5.min.js,之前因为忘记引入,导致项目里面删除和编辑图标出不来。...鼠标移动到 删除按钮 上,浏览器自动弹出辅助信息内容,可根据用户需要自行修改。...renameTitle编辑名称按钮 Title 辅助信息,设置鼠标移动到 编辑名称按钮 上,浏览器自动弹出辅助信息内容,可根据用户需要自行修改。...onRemove : zTreeOnRemove删除节点,弹出被删除节点 tId 以及 name 信息。

2.2K41

杨老师课堂之Jquery筛选,事件,效果,Ajax,javascript跨域)

可以用同样方法解决 元素上问题 阻止默认行为 网页中元素都有自己默认行为,例如:单击超链接后悔跳转,单击”提交”按钮会表单会提交,有时需要阻止元素默认行为 jquery中,提供了preventDefault...举一个例子,项目中,经常需要验证表单,单击”提交”按钮是,验证表单内容,例如元素是否是必填字段,某元素长度是否够6位,单表单不符合提交条件,要阻止表单提交 eg: $(“#sub”).bind(...该方法作用是获取到光标相对于页面的x坐标和y坐标.如果没有使用jquery,那么IE浏览器中 是使用event.pageX()和event.pageY()方法.如果页面上有滚动条,则还要加上滚动条宽度和高...【掌握】 第一层,最原始层,$.ajax,一般不使用,完成更强大功能需要使用。...•页面初次加载不需要加载全部javascript文件,需要动态加载 jQuery.getJSON(url, [data], [callback]) 通过 HTTP GET 请求载入 JSON

8.2K20
领券